Harm Reduction

We believe in using a compassionate, judgment-free approach to harm reduction — meeting clients where they are in their journey toward wellness. Our counselors work collaboratively with individuals who may be navigating substance use, self-harm, or other high-risk behaviors, focusing on reducing immediate harm while building trust and supporting long-term goals.

​

Rather than demanding abstinence as a starting point, we help clients identify safer strategies, explore underlying emotional triggers, & gradually move toward healthier choices at a pace that feels safe and sustainable. This client-centered model respects autonomy, promotes dignity, & prioritizes safety—empowering individuals to make meaningful changes without fear of stigma or shame.

Substance Use Support

Our counselors understand that substance use often intersects with trauma, stress, or underlying mental health conditions, & we approach each client with empathy & without judgment.

 

Whether a client’s goal is harm reduction, moderation, or full recovery, we work collaboratively to develop a treatment plan that aligns with their values and readiness for change.

 

Using evidence-based therapies such as Motivational Interviewing,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), & trauma-informed care, we help clients explore the root causes of their substance use, build healthier coping strategies, & strengthen resilience.

 

We also collaborate with medical providers, recovery programs, & support networks when appropriate to ensure holistic and coordinated care.

School Coordination

We work closely with schools to support students facing emotional, behavioral, or learning challenges. Our contract with Portland Public Schools allows us to be present in schools during class hours to help lower barriers to care.

 

We collaborate with teachers, school counselors, & administrators to share insights, recommend accommodations, & advocate for the student’s needs within the school environment.

 

Whether it’s participating in IEP or 504 Plan meetings, providing clinical input, or helping bridge communication between families & schools, our goal is to ensure students receive consistent, supportive care across settings.

 

This coordinated approach fosters stability, resilience, & academic success for students navigating mental health concerns.
